AUTHOR=Wan Chuchuan , Wang Qiqi , Xu Zhaoqi , Huang Yuankai , Xi Xiaoyu TITLE=Mapping health assessment questionnaire disability index onto EQ-5D-5L in China JOURNAL=Frontiers in Public Health VOLUME=Volume 11 - 2023 YEAR=2023 URL=https://www.frontiersin.org/journals/public-health/articles/10.3389/fpubh.2023.1123552 DOI=10.3389/fpubh.2023.1123552 ISSN=2296-2565 ABSTRACT=Objective: This research aimed to develop the more accurate mapping algorithms from health assessment questionnaire disability index (HAQ-DI) onto EQ-5D-5L based on Chinese Rheumatoid Arthritis patients. Methods: The cross-sectional data of Chinese RA patients was used for constructing the mapping algorithms. Direct mapping using Ordinary least squares regression (OLS), the general linear regression model (GLM), MM-estimator model (MM), Tobit regression model (Tobit), Beta regression model (Beta) and the adjusted limited dependent variable mixture model (ALDVMM) and response mapping using Multivariate Ordered Probit regression model (MV-Probit) were carried out. HAQ-DI score, age, gender, BMI, DAS28-ESR and PtAAP were included as the explanatory variables. The bootstrap was used for validation of mapping algorithms and mean absolute error (MAE), root mean square error (RMSE), adjusted R2 (adjR2) and concordance correlation coefficient (CCC) were used to assess the predictive ability of the mapping algorithms. Results: According to the average rank of MAE, RMSE, adjR2 and CCC, the mapping algorithm based on Beta performed the best. And the mapping algorithm performed better as the number of variables increasing. Conclusion: The mapping algorithms provided in this research can help researchers to obtain the health utility values more accurately. And researchers can choose the mapping algorithms under different combinations of variables based on the actual data.
